Let's put it in language the Signal leakers will understand: what a bunch of pathetic sleazebags | Emma Brockes

The leaking of top-level military secrets was bad enough, but I’m obsessed with Maga’s fratboy lexiconThe Maga-fication of American political discourse, which started, arguably, with Donald Trump mocking a disabled reporter in 2015, peaked this week with news of Pete Hegseth referring to European countries in the leaked Signal chat as “PATHETIC”, and enjoyed a detour last Tuesday when Tim Walz, the governor of Minnesota and former running mate of Kamala Harris, appeared at a town hall in Wisconsin and called Elon Musk “a dipshit”. (This is not the first time he has referred to Musk this way. Right before the election last year, Walz told a crowd: “Look, Elon’s on that stage, jumping around, skipping like a dipshit.”)Parking for a moment the perfection of the phrase “skipping like a dipshit” to capture Musk’s very particular style of movement and speech, the range of what can and can’t be said in politics has clearly, radically changed. Emma Brockes criticizes the leaked Signal chat of Trump's team, focusing on the crude language used by figures like Pete Hegseth. The author contrasts this with past political discourse, highlighting how the MAGA movement has normalized such language. The White House response to the leak is deemed hypocritical and further exposes the Trump team's actions.
